Default clutch master/slave

what happens if you push in the clutch without it being connected to the bellhousing?
the clutch has previously been installed but the plastic strap never broke until...it got pushed in while not installed.
is everything going to be okay or did something bad happen?

Breaking the plastic strap won't hurt anything. Its just there to hold the rod in position while you bolt it to the bellhousing.

How hard did you push the pedal? If the slave is fully extended out, the clutch pedal will be hard. If you force the pedal down when its hard like this, something will probably crack open and puke fluid everywhere, usually the slave.

If you didn't push the pedal hard and nothing exploded, you've prbobaly got nothing to worry about.
